WPF动态修改控件的位置
WPF中动态改变控件位置的方法
实例如下:
预定条件:在窗体中先加入一个名为“myButton”的Button。双击该Button;
在生成的事件处理函数中添加如下代码:
double left=myButton.Margin.Left;
double top=myButton.Margin.Top;
myButton.Margin= new Thickness(left - 50, top, 0, 0);
则点击该按钮后,按钮的位置就会水平向左移动“50”。。。。
结论:通过设置控件的Margin属性的值改变控件在相应容器中的位置(该容器不一定是窗体,也可能是窗体内的Grid或其他Pannel等)。
就是这么简单。。。。
相关主题